    At the end of the past year, Anderson Manufacturing launched the Kiger-9c, a Glock 19 Gen3 parts compatible pistol that offers some differences from the G19 in terms of ergonomics and appearance while retaining the reliable core mechanism of the perfection pistols. The company has now announced a new version of this pistol called Kiger-9c Pro which is lighter than the regular Kiger-9c thanks to the lightening cuts in the slide and fluted barrel as well as features suppressor-height sights, an optics-ready slide and extended controls (slide release and magazine release).

    Anderson Manufacturing Kiger-9c Pro pistol is chambered in 9mm Luger and has a 3.91″ straight-fluted barrel that features a recessed crown. Both the barrel and slide are made of 416 stainless steel and have a DLC finish. The red dot cut on the slide is of an RMR footprint and the iron sights are made of steel. The polymer frame features an undercut trigger guard, a beveled magazine well, and a 1913 accessory rail. The trigger pull weight is 5.5 lbs. The overall length of the Kiger-9c Pro pistol is 7.35″ and it weighs in at 3.2 lbs. There is also a suppressor-ready version of this pistol called Kiger9c Pro SR that comes with a non-fluted 1/2×28 threaded barrel and tuned recoil spring.

    Anderson Manufacturing Kiger-9c PRO Pistol (3)

    The MSRP of the Anderson Manufacturing Kiger-9c Pro pistol is $539, which is $110 more than the retail price of the regular Kiger-9c. The Kiger-9c Pro SR is priced at $549. These pistols come with one Magpul GL9 15-round magazine. Kiger-9c Pro pistols are made in the USA and are backed by a lifetime warranty.
